overflow
-
CSS溢出滚动overflow-y overflow-x使用技巧
使用 overflow-x 和 overflow-y 可精准控制元素溢出行为,推荐多数场景设为 auto 以提升体验;通过设置 overflow-y: auto 实现垂直滚动、overflow-x: auto 支持横向滑动,结合 hidden 避免冗余滚动条;处理嵌套滚动时应避免冲突,可利用 ove…
-
CSS响应式布局如何处理固定和流动元素_position与flex结合
使用Flexbox实现一侧固定、一侧自适应的响应式布局,结合position处理局部定位需求。1. 父容器设display: flex,固定元素设宽度,流动元素设flex: 1;2. 需绝对定位时,在flex子项内设置position: relative/absolute,确保层级清晰;3. 移动端…
-
怎样学习电脑基础知识?
在学习编程之前,打好电脑基础知识这块地基很重要,那么电脑基础知识应该如何学习呢?php小编草莓为大家带来学习计算机基础的详细教程,帮助大家轻松入门电脑知识,为编程学习奠定坚实基础。快来关注具体内容吧! 一、怎样学习电脑基础知识? 电脑的基本知识包括,学会电脑的开机和关机,学会如何进行电脑木马杀毒,对…
-
CSS浮动如何使用_float属性详解与布局应用
浮动(float)用于元素左右排列,实现图文环绕和多列布局,但会导致父容器高度塌陷,需通过clear、overflow或伪元素清除浮动;虽可构建两栏或三列布局,但响应式差、维护难,现代开发推荐使用Flexbox和Grid替代。 浮动(float)是CSS中用于控制元素在父容器内左右排列的一种布局方式…
-
如何使用CSS设置元素外边距_margin属性应用方法
margin用于控制元素外边距,提升页面布局清晰度;支持四方向设置或统一设置,可使用px、%、auto等值;通过margin: 0 auto可实现块级元素水平居中;需注意垂直方向相邻元素的margin合并问题,常取较大值,可通过设置单边margin、添加border或触发BFC避免。 在网页布局中,…
-
如何在CSS中实现卡片浮动排列_Float margin padding布局优化
使用float、margin和padding可实现网页中常见的卡片浮动布局,适用于图片、商品等多列展示。通过设置.card元素左浮动、固定宽度与外边距,配合父容器overflow:hidden清除浮动,结合box-sizing:border-box和媒体查询优化响应式表现,避免错位。推荐现代项目采用…
-
如何在CSS中实现响应式轮播图自动播放_Animation keyframes与grid flex结合实践
使用CSS Grid、Flexbox和@keyframes可实现无JavaScript的响应式轮播图:1. 用语义化HTML结构配合–slide-count自定义属性;2. Grid布局控制容器居中与宽高比;3. Flexbox水平排列图片并防止压缩;4. @keyframes定义平移动…
-
如何在CSS中使用Flex实现垂直居中_align-items与height结合
使用Flex布局实现垂直居中的关键是设置父容器display: flex、align-items: center并确保容器有明确高度,如height: 200px或100vh,子元素将自动在交叉轴上居中,无需额外定位样式。 在CSS中使用Flex布局实现垂直居中,关键在于正确设置容器的display…
-
如何在CSS中使用绝对定位_Position absolute与父容器结合布局方案
绝对定位元素脱离文档流,相对于最近的已定位祖先定位;若父容器设为relative,则子元素以该容器为参考,通过top、left等属性精确定位,常用于模态框、图标叠加、下拉菜单等场景,需注意包含块、尺寸控制及响应式适配,避免布局错乱。 在CSS布局中,position: absolute 是一种强大的…
-
如何在CSS中实现弹出框固定_Position fixed结合transition动画应用
使用 position: fixed 和 transition 可创建平滑动画的固定弹出框。1. 用 position: fixed 将弹出框固定在视口,配合 top、left 和 transform 居中,z-index 确保层级,叠加遮罩层;2. 通过 opacity、visibility 和 …